Not Vodafone client wanting to unlock iphone

Hello

 

I bought an iphone 4 on the internet and it is not unlocked. So I contacted apple store here in Portugal and they told me I should contact vodafone uk since it was originally bought there. 

I've read the form to unlock but since I'm not a vodafone uk and neither vodafone portugal user I thought best to ask for advice.

Hi there

 

The issue that you have is that only the original owner can request the unlocking if the phone was originally supplied on contract. They need to complete the NUC Request Webform with their account info.

 

I would recommend that you get in touch with the person who sold it to you and speak to them about getting the device unlocked.

Put the phone back on Ebay and sell it to someone in the UK who uses Vodafone UK as there is absolutely no possibility whatsoever of Vodafone unlocking the phone for anyone other than the original owner. If you can get the original owner to request the unlock you'll be ok but otherwise there is no chance.
